![]() ![]() As each world is completed, the player receives a postcard for that world. In the earliest levels of the game, objectives include sinking anchors and breaking ice the objective is to accomplish a target number of each, for example to sink a specified number of anchors. Worlds differ in gameplay elements, obstacles and objectives. Levels are grouped into "worlds" the first ten levels make up the first world, while subsequent worlds contain 25 or more levels. At the start of the game, only level one is unlocked each subsequent level is unlocked only when the previous level is beaten. Unlike Dots, Two Dots has power-ups, objectives and a campaign (series of levels), while lacking online multi-player capability. It was released for iOS platforms on May 29, 2014, and became available for Android on November 12, 2014. The Graphviz layout programs take descriptions of graphs in a simple text language, and make diagrams in useful formats, such as images and SVG for web pages PDF or Postscript for inclusion in other documents or display in an interactive graph browser. It has important applications in networking, bioinformatics, software engineering, database and web design, machine learning, and in visual interfaces for other technical domains.
